Knight Online "DbAgent / Ebenezer SQL Connection Selhalo" Řešení chyby
Při spouštění vašeho soukromého serveru Knight Online Ebenezer.exe, Ais_Server.exe nebo DbAgent.exe zamrznutí modulů na úvodní obrazovce nebo opakovaně "Spojení SQL se nezdařilo" / "Chyba ODBC" Chyba označuje, že hlavní soubory hry nemohou komunikovat s databází SQL Server. Bez vyřešení této chyby není možné otevřít server. Pro přesné řešení můžete postupovat podle níže uvedených kroků jeden po druhém.
Metoda 1: Kontrola konfigurace zdrojů dat ODBC (DSN).
Knight Online exe soubory používají hypertextové odkazy ODBC v operačním systému Windows pro připojení k databázi. Chybějící nebo nesprávná identifikace těchto hypertextových odkazů zcela přeruší spojení:
- do nabídky Start systému Windows Zdroje dat ODBC (32bitové) Otevřete panel zadáním . *(Důležité: Protože herní soubory běží na 32bitové architektuře, musíte zvolit 32bitový panel).*
- Systémové DSN Klepněte na kartu.
- tady
KN_Online,Knight_DB,Account_DBZkontrolujte, zda jsou definovány názvy ODBC potřebné pro vaši infrastrukturu souborů, jako jsou soubory. - Pokud jsou definovány, poklepejte na ně a zadejte své uživatelské jméno pro SQL Server (obvykle `sa`) a heslo SQL. "Testovací zdroj dat" Stiskněte tlačítko. Pokud test selže, je vaše heslo SQL nebo název serveru nesprávné.
Metoda 2: Kontrola hesla a názvů databáze v souborech INI
I když jsou vaše připojení ODBC správná, informace v souborech nastavení v souborech serveru mohou být zapsány nesprávně:
- ve složce vašeho serveru
Ebenezer.ini,Ais_Server.iniaDbAgent.iniOtevřete soubory. - obsažené uvnitř
[ODBC]nebo[DATABASE]pod nadpisy DSN, UID (h) a PWD (Vaše heslo SQL) Zkontrolujte pole. - Ujistěte se, že názvy databází jsou přesně stejné jako názvy na serveru SQL Server (např. `KN_ONLINE`, `KO_MAIN`), až na velká a malá písmena.
Metoda 3: Aktivace serveru SQL Server "Pojmenované kanály" a protokoly TCP/IP
Ve výchozím nastavení může instalace SQL Serveru vypnout požadavky na připojení TCP/IP z externích nebo místních služeb. Postup zapnutí těchto protokolů:
- Z nabídky Start systému Windows SQL Server Configuration Manager Otevřete program.
- Konfigurace sítě SQL Server -> Protokoly pro MSSQLSERVER Přejděte na kartu.
- Nachází se vpravo Pojmenované Pipes a TCP/IP stav možností "Povoleno" Změňte jej na (Aktivní) a restartujte službu SQL Server (Restartovat).
Tento článek je speciálně připraven pro PvPServer.